Applied statistics courses can help you learn data analysis, hypothesis testing, regression techniques, and experimental design. You can build skills in interpreting data sets, making predictions, and communicating statistical findings effectively. Many courses introduce tools like R, Python, and Excel, that support performing statistical analyses and visualizing data.
